Posted in

Sr Business Systems Analyst

Sr Business Systems Analyst

CompanyTD Bank
LocationCharlotte, NC, USA
Salary$115000 – $160000
TypeFull-Time
DegreesBachelor’s
Experience LevelSenior

Requirements

  • Undergraduate degree or Technical Certificate
  • 5+ years relevant experience
  • Advanced communications, problem-solving and decision making skills
  • Experience in moderate scale corporate systems analysis
  • Ability to work with systems users or potential users to develop system specifications and requirements
  • Ability to translate user requirements into technical specifications with limited guidance

Responsibilities

  • Communicates with programmers to ensure understanding of business processes and requirements of the users
  • Works with programmers to ensure understanding of business processes and requirements of the processes to ensure that the delivered system matches the specified features and functions
  • Participates in the assessment of available technologies recommending innovative and cost-effective solutions
  • Maps current business processes to new systems and participate in the transition to the new solution
  • Determines interface requirements for effective system transition
  • Develops detailed specification documents that include features and functions of the new system
  • Develops test plans and test case scenarios to guarantee the new system design meets business requirements
  • Implements assigned new system installations, upgrade and conversions
  • Documents selected system parameters, file layouts and application design layouts
  • Tracks open issues and resolution of issues
  • Responsible for analyzing a broad range of business requirements, conducting program/system research and analysis to identify key components for solutions delivery and problem resolution
  • Develops new applications and performs unit/component test for new application development initiatives aligned to business needs and in accordance with technology architecture standards
  • Ensures effective communication of solutions development requirements for respective area and contributes to project plans, estimations, timelines and status updates to support management team/clients on prioritizing new and existing projects against IT requirements and business objectives
  • Informs key stakeholders of any issues that may impact other areas of the project and resolves or escalates issues as required
  • Supports business inquiries and business activities through execution of small enhancements and break/fix implementations (e.g. source code changes)
  • Works with Business Analysts/Systems Analysts, other technology Developers/Solution Designers to ensure the configuration and custom components meet application requirements and performance goals
  • Creates and maintains quality code, ensures defect free programming consistent with standards; provides code maintenance and supports during testing cycles and post-production deployment and participate in reviewing peer coding
  • Adheres to standard security coding practices to ensure application is free of most common coding vulnerabilities
  • Participates in identifying and recommending development/testing solutions/tools in support of project/application objectives
  • Completes unit and integration testing for conformance to standards and adherence to design specifications
  • Complies with well-defined enterprise technology delivery practices and standards and project management disciplines by participating in scope assessment, risk and cost analysis
  • Assists in the development/maintenance of comprehensive processes for prevention of issues and participate in problem determination and timely resolution of incidents applying appropriate quality measures
  • Perform Systems Administration of applications/environments supported by the LOB, monitors application/service performance, and performs configuration, backup, authentication & tuning
  • Ensure both state-of-health monitoring and monthly SLA targets are in place, and are being met
  • Provides technical expertise during Incident management, analyzes incident reports and outages, performs impact assessment for incidents and facilitates internal and external communication throughout incident resolution
  • Continuously enhances knowledge/expertise in area and keeps current with leading-edge technologies, emerging trends/developments and grows knowledge of the business, applications, infrastructure, analytical tools and techniques
  • Prioritizes and manages own workload in order to deliver quality results and meet timelines as assigned
  • Supports a positive work environment that promotes service to the business, quality, innovation and teamwork and ensures timely communication of issues/points of interest
  • Identifies and recommends opportunities to enhance productivity, effectiveness and operational efficiency of the business unit and/or team
  • Establishes effective relationships across multiple business and technology partners, program and project managers
  • Participates in knowledge transfer within the team and business units
  • Impact assessment for incidents and facilitates internal and external communication throughout incident resolution

Preferred Qualifications

    No preferred qualifications provided.